Key Responsibilities

  • •Manage personnel by providing onsite direction and guidance throughout the workday.
  • •Plan, troubleshoot, and schedule daily work assignments; assign priorities; requisition materials and equipment.
  • •Prepare and maintain required written records, logs, progress reports, time/weight tickets, attendance records, and safety/inspection documents.
  • •Read and understand blueprints, charts, maps, and other construction drawings and plans.
  • •Consult with other project supervisors and engineers, attend meetings, perform on-site inspections, and conduct weekly safety meetings.

Key Requirements

  • •Multiple, demonstrated years of experience with underground wet utilities installation (water, sewer, storm drain).
  • •Extensive equipment “seat time” operating experience, including utility installation and in-trench work.
  • •Thorough knowledge of underground utility installation practices.
  • •Valid driver’s license.
  • •Ability to read and comprehend blueprints, site specifications, and written instructions.
